About Lawali Village
Lawali is a small village in Pauri tehsil, in the district of Garhwal, Uttarakhand. The Census of India 2011 recorded a population of 105, made up of 57 males and 48 females. That works out to a sex ratio of about 842 females per 1000 males. The village covers 16.94 hectares hectares. Its pincode is 246001, shared with the other villages in the same post office area.

Getting to Lawali
The census records public bus service for Lawali as Available within village. Private bus service is recorded as Available within village. For rail, the census notes the nearest railway station as Available within 10+ km distance. These entries describe what was recorded in 2011 and services may have changed since.
